This fun and playful board book introduces young children to the world of boats in their many forms. There are tall boats and small boats and heave-and-haul boats, and more!
From the author and illustrator of Go, Bikes, Go!, this delightful board book celebrates Pacific Northwest boating and maritime culture with a focus on recreational watercraft and working boats that are popular in the region.
Young children will be fascinated by the variety of boats depicted in the vibrant and playful illustrations showing diverse families enjoying sailboats, kayaks, rafts, canoes, houseboats, and more!
ADDIE BOSWELL is a writer, artist, and muralist who lives in Portland, Oregon. Addie's first book, The Rain Stomper (Two Lions, 2008), won the 2009 Oregon Spirit Award. She was also included in Oregon Reads Aloud, a 2016 collection of the state's top authors and illustrators.
ALEXANDER MOSTOV is an illustrator who takes pride in making playful, accessible pictures. His inspiration is drawn from plants, animals, and midcentury-modern design. He lives in Seattle with lots of books and a mischievous little dog named Dziga.
